Risk Response Strategy

Plan Risk Response – the process of developing options and actions to enhance or exploit opportunities and to reduce or eliminate threats to project objectives. 

Risk Response planning must be appropriate to: Severity of the risk,Cost in meeting the challenge,Timely to be successful, Realistic, Agreed by all parties,Owned by responsible person.
 Strategies for Negative Risks and Threads:
  1. Avoid (Avoidance) The focus of this strategy is to eliminate the cause of the risks. Taking the action to ensure the risk does not occur. This often accomplished by removing people and/or activities.
  2. Transfer (Transference): This responses transfers accountability and responsibility of a risk to a third party. The third party actually performs the work or takes accountability. There is normally a cost incurred when using the transfer or transference response. A prime example of transference is the purchase of insurance
  3. Mitigate (Mitigation): This response take actions to reduce the probability of risk occurring, or the impact of risk if it occurs. This could be thought of as developing a Plan B. An example is training. We try to reduce the probability and impact of employees performing poorly on the job training them.
  4. Accept (Acceptance). This response entails taking no immediate action until the risk occurs. There are two types of acceptance strategies listed below. One is passive and the other is active.
    • Acceptance is a response strategy appropriate for BOTH negative and positive risks
    • A contingency Plan or Fallback Plan may be developed for a risk you plan to accept. However, the response will not be initiated until the risk occurs
    • Acceptance is often the only choice when risks are generated from external sources, or when risk responses are beyond the control of the Project Manager
    • Passive Acceptance: This type of acceptance occurs when no Contingency Plans are created to address the risk.
    • Active Acceptance: Develop Contingency Plans to address the risk when it occurs. Active Acceptance is a solid option when necessary to convince risk averse stakeholders that a response plan for accepted risks is in place

Strategies for Positive Risks and Opportunities:
  1. Exploit (Exploitation): This is a response that takes action to make a cause occur. Steps are taken to ensure the risk happens. It may require additional time or resources to use the exploit response method. This is the opposite of the avoid response.
  2. Share (Sharing): This response enlist the support of a third party to take advantage of the opportunities presented by a positive risk event. Partnering with a third party allows both parties to share in the benefits. This is the opposite of the transfer response. Teaming agreements are an example of a share response.
  3. Enhance (Enhancing): This response aims to increase the probability of the risk occurring or the impact of a risk if it occurs. Incentives are a common example of an enhance response. This is the opposite of the mitigate response
  4. Accept (Acceptance): Acceptance is a feasible risk response for both negative and positive risks.

Project Risk Management

Risk Management is something that we always do even without thinking about it. Risk management involves minimizing the consequences of adverse events as well as maximizing the results of positive events. Therefore, risks can be good or bad events which are commonly called as opportunities or threads.

Risk management is a part of the project management process, and consistently following that process is important for getting results. It allows you to take control of the project, rather than letting the project control you. 

The six processes in Risk Management based on PMBOK Guide is designed to help manage end-to-end project risk. An acronym was developed to remember the steps in this process is PIER-C, Plan, Identify, Evaluate, Respond, and Control.

Risk Definition
Project risk is defined as "An uncertain event or condition that, if it occurs, has a positive or negative effect on at least one of the project's objectives" Project objectives are defined as scope, time, cost, and quality.

The PMI Risk Management Process: PIER-C
PMI developed an interrelated six (6) step approach to manage project risk.The PIER process activities or steps occur during Project Planning Process Group. The Monitor and Control Risks activity occurs during the Project Monitoring and Controlling Process Group, this is the C.
 
  1.  Plan Risk Management:  This initial step defines how risk management will be accomplished (methodology). The ultimate goal is to develop a Risk Management Plan which describes how the entire end-to-end Risk Management Process will work.
  2. Identify Risks: This steps requires you to develop a list of risk by project, activity, work package, etc. During this step, you define the risk, assign initial ownership, define risk causes, develop initial responses, and categorize each risk. The key output of identify risks is a document referred to as the Risk Register.
  3. Perform Qualitative Risk Analysis: This step is the first evaluation step. This is subjective process. During this step, you use the Risk Register to classify risks by probability (likelihood the risk will occur) and impact (effect of the risk consequence on the project). At the end of this step, prioritize all risks and establish a short list of risks that must be aggressively managed. This is often referred to as the Urgent List. You also place low probability and impact risks in a separate section of the Risk Register, which is called Watch List. At the conclusion of this step is the risk register updated.
  4. Perform Quantitative Risk Analysis: This step is optional. The Project Manager decides ! You may or may not Perform Quantitative Risk Analysis. This decision is determined by factors such as time, project priority, level of effort as compared to benefits, etc. This evaluation method numerically analyzes the impact of multiple risks to the project. This is an objective method that helps determine probability that stated budgetary and schedule outcomes can be met. The risk register updated is the output of this step.
  5. Plan Risk Responses: During this step, develop responses to risks on the urgent or "short"list of risks. The level of response detail is dictated by the priority of the risk. Strive for the responses that address both positive risks (opportunities) and negative risks (threats). The risk register updated is the output of this step as well. In addition, contractual agreements may be developed to support responses that require third party involvement.
  6.  Monitor and Control Risk: This is the final step in the Risk Management Process. During this step, monitor and reassess risks on the Risk Register. Implement risk responses as necessary. Identify new or emergent risks that were not identified during the identify risks activity. In addition, evaluate the effectiveness of the risk program for the overall project. 

When to Start Risk Management

PMBOK has nine knowledge areas. Risk management comes at the end of the project planning stage, because, for risk management, you need input from other knowledge areas. The only knowledge area that is planned after risk management is procurement management, because you often need to include causes to manage specific risks in your project. This only becomes clear after risk response planning. For example, you decide the contractor should be responsible for risks that may occur due to expected new legislations, then this must be spelled out in the agreement with the contractor.

Project Human Resource Management

There are number of pertinent topics in Project Human Resources that are very important to memorize and understand if you want to take either PMP or PMI-RMP (Project Management Institute - Risk Management Professional) exam.

They include:
  • Motivational Theories 
  • Leadership Style
  • Leadership Style Applicability
  • Negotiation Methods

A. MOTIVATIONAL THEORIES

Motivation impact stakeholder attitudes. Be aware of the following motivational theories and the individuals who responsible for each when applicable
 
MOTIVATIONAL THEORY KEY POINTS
Expectancy Theory Employees believe effort leads to performance. Performance should be rewarded based on individual expectations. Rewards promote further productivity
McGregor's Theory X and Y All workers fit into 1 of 2 groups. 
Theory X, managers believe people are not to be trusted and must be watched.
Theory Y, managers believe people should be trusted, want to achieve success, and are self-directed
Maslow's Hierarchy of Needs Theory Maslow stated that motivation occurs in a hierarchical manner. Each level must be attained before moving to the next

(Physiological - Safety - Social - Esteem - Self Actualization)
Achievement Motivation Theory David McClelland states that there are three needs that must be met for people to be satisfied. They include achievement, affiliation, and power.
Hertzberg' Theory There are hygiene factors and motivating agents.
Hygiene factors such as salary, working conditions, benefits, etc. They do not increase motivation.
Motivating factors such as responsibility, growth, and achievement are those that increase motivation.


B. LEADERSHIP STYLES

Leadership styles also impact stakeholder support of the Risk Management Process. Each style must be used on a situational basis.

LEADERSHIP STYLE DEFINITION
Directive Tell people what to do
Facilitative Coordinate and solicit the input of others. A good Project Manager is facilitative
Coaching Train and instruct others on how to perform the work
Supporting Provide assistance and support as needed to achieve project goals
Consensus Building Solve problems based on group input. Strive for decision buy in and agreement
Consultative Invite others to provide input and ideas
Autocratic Make decisions without input from others


Tuckman Model: is a common five-step model used to depict growth of a team from the moment it is formed. This model is used to determine appropriate situation leadership style


STAGE CHARACTERISTICS
Forming Team meets and learns about the project. Roles are discussed. Expect hesitancy, confusion, anxiety, lack of purpose, and lack of identity. Productivity is low
Storming Team begins to address work, technical decisions, and project management approaches. Conflict can occur which may disrupt the team. Leadership is challenged, cliques form, etc. Productivity decreases
Norming Team members begin to work together. They adjust individual habits to accommodate the team. There is open communication, purpose, confidence, motivation, etc. Productivity improves
Performing Teams are independent, self-directed, and work through issues quickly and smoothly. There is pride and trust. Productivity peaks
Adjourning Team completes all work and moves on


C. LEADERSHIP STYLE APPLICABILITY

Each leadership style can be used to support a variety of situations. The table shows common situations and recommended leadership

SITUATION BEST LEADERSHIP STYLE
Team is forming and new. They need direction and task oriented information Directive; Coaching
Team is storming. There is much conflict, frustration, and confusion Facilitative; Consensus Building; Consultative
A decision must be made quickly. Time is of the essence. There is little time for input  Autocratic
The team is well established and skilled. They are in the norm or perform stages Supporting


D. NEGOTIATION

There are some tips to negotiate with stakeholders:
  • Understand and be able to explain the needs of the project. Be able to specifically spell out "what, why, who, where, when, and how factors" impacting project risk
  • Be able to explain the business need for the project in an effort to gain support. The Functional Manager may not recognize project risks, benefits, etc
  • Understand that key stakeholders have other jobs to do. Understand their work situations. Be realistic
  • Build a relationship. Find out how to assist the stakeholder and create a win-win situation surrounding the need for their support
  • Be willing to compromise. Be flexible

Project Management Plan

What is Project Management Plan???

In terms of project management in planning process, a Project Management plan is the most important document that needed to perform work. The project management plan is the sole outputs of develop project management plan in integration management. 

Project Management Plan is a formal and approved document that defines how the project is executed, monitored and controlled. It may be in a form of an executive summary or a detailed document, and it may compose one or more subsidiary management plans and other planning documents
Project plan is used to:
  • Guide project execution
  • Document project planning assumption
  • Document project planning decision based on the selected alternatives
  • Facilitate communication among stakeholders
  • Define key management review 
  • Provide a baseline for progress measurement and project control
The keys to understanding the project management plan:
  1. The project management plan is formal. It is important to think of the project management plan as a formal, written piece of communication.
  2. The project management plan is a single document. It is not 15 separate plans. One those separate documents are approved as the project plan, they become a single document.
  3. The project management plan is approved. In other words, there is a point in time at which it officially becomes the project plan. Who approves it is going to differ based on the organizational structure and other factors, but typically it would be the project manager, the project sponsor, the functional managers who are providing resources for the project.  
  4. The project management plan defines how the project is managed, executed, and controlled. This means that the document provides the guidance on how the bulk of the project will be conducted.
  5. The project management plan may be summary or detailed. 
Components of Project Management Plan:
  • Change Management Plan
  • Configure Management Plan
  • Scope Management Plan
  • Time Management Plan
  • Cost Management Plan
  • Quality Management Plan
  • Process Improved Plan
  • Human Resources Plan
  • Communication Management Plan
  • Risk Management Plan
  • Procurement Management Plan
  • Requirements Management Plan
  • Scope Baseline
  • Cost Performance Baseline
  • Schedule Baseline

 

Project Scope Management



Project Scope Management includes the processes required to ensure that the project includes all the work required, and only the work required, to complete the project successfully.

Remember, Scope Management means:
- Constantly checking to make sure all the work are completed
- No additional work include in the Project Charter
- Preventing extra work or gold platting

Process in Project Scope Management:
1. Collect Requirements, the process of defining and documenting stakeholder’s needs to 
     meet the project objectives
 
     Key Inputs: Stakeholder Register
     Key Tools & Techniques:  Facilitated Workshops, Group Creativity Techniques
     Key Outputs: Requirement Documentation, Requirement Traceability Matrix
 
2.  Define Scope: the process of developing a detailed description of project and product
     
     Key Inputs:Project Charter, Requirement Documentations
     Key Tools & Techniques:  Alternatives Identification
     Key Outputs: Project Scope Statement

3.  Create WBS: the process of subdividing project deliverable and project work into smaller 
     and more manageable components

     Key Inputs:Project Scope Statement
     Key Tools & Techniques:  Decomposition
     Key Outputs: WBS, WBS Dictionary, Scope Baseline

4.  Verify Scope: the process of formalizing acceptance of the completed project deliverable

     Key Inputs:Project Management Plan
     Key Tools & Techniques:  Inspection
     Key Outputs: Accepted Deliverable, Change Request

5.  Control Scope: the process of monitoring project status, product scope, and managing 
     changes 

     Key Inputs:Project Management Plan, Work Performance Information
     Key Tools & Techniques:  Variance Analysis
     Key Outputs: Work Performance Measurements

Differences between Verify Scope and Perform Quality Control
Verify Scope:
- Is often performed after Perform Quality Control
- Is primarily concerned with completeness
- Is concerned with the acceptance of the product by the project manager, the sponsor, the 
  customer and others

Perform Quality Control:
- It is not unusual for these processes to be performed at the same time
- Is primarily concerned with correctness
- Is concerned with adherence to the quality specification
 
Important Note: 
If the project is canceled before completion, Verify Scope should be performed to document
where the product was in relation to the scope at the point when the project ended

Project Integration Management

Project Integration Management is the processes required to ensure that the various project elements are coordinated effectively. Integration management is the practice of making certain that every part of the project is coordinated.

DEVELOP PROJECT CHARTER


Project Charter is used to authorize a project to begin and to provide the project manager with the authority necessary to execute the project. The Project Manager should be identified and assigned as early in the project as is feasible, but always prior to project planning and preferably during project charter development. The project charter should be issued by project sponsor or other persons at a level sufficient in the organization to commit funding.

Input:
  • Project Statement of Work (a written description of the project's product, service, or result)
  • Business Case
  • Contract
  • Enterprise Environmental Factors
  • Organizational Process Assets
Project Charter outline: business need, product description, constraint, assumption, statement of authority and accountability, project manager authority, project manager responsibilities.

PERFORM INTEGRATED CHANGE CONTROL

means coordinating changes across the project. The process includes reviewing requests, approving changes and controlling changes to the deliverable (any unique and verifiable product, result or capability to perform a service that is identified in the project management planning documentation and must be produced and provided to complete the project).

Output
  • Change Request Status Update
Tools & Techniques
  • Expert Judgement
Concerned with:
  • Influencing the factors that create changes to ensure that changes are agreed upon
  • Determining that change has occurred
  • Managing the actual change when they occurs

CLOSE PROJECT OR PHASE

The process of finalizing all activities across Project Management Process Groups to formally complete the project or phase.
Close
Project or Phase is all about shutting the project down properly. This includes creating the necessary documentation and archives, capturing the lesson learned, ensuring that contract is properly closed, and updating all organizational process assets.
